2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L Power & Handling
You will be able to find two different engines when you check out the Jeep Grand Cherokee L. The base engine is a 3.6-liter V6, which can output as much as 290 horsepower and 257 pound-feet of torque. You’ll find this engine pa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ission and either RWD or 4WD. The other engine you can get is a 5.7-liter V8, which produces up to 390 pound-feet of torque and 357 horsepower. Here you’ll get the same transmission and drivetrain options. 2021 Chevy Traverse Power & Handling
Only one engine comes with the 2021 Traverse. This engine is a 3.6-liter V6, which can output around 266 pound-feet of torque and 310 horsepower. Front-wheel drive is standard, though you can get all-wheel drive. The lack of any other engine and four-wheel drive automatically puts the Traverse at a very real disadvantage. 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L Features & Design
Beyond just being powerful, the Grand Cherokee L works hard to give you all of the features you need to make every drive that much more enjoyable. Standard features here include adaptive cruise control, LED headlights, a power driver’s-seat, a leather-wrapped steering wheel, automatic emergency braking, dual-zone automatic climate control, cloth seats, paddle shifters, and 18-inch alloy wheels. Some optional features include a 9-speaker Alpine audio system, navigation, hill-descent control, electronic adaptive damping, massaging front seats, Park Assist, a gloss-black roof, and perforated Nappa leather upholstery.
2021 Chevy Traverse Features & Design
Now is the time to see if the Traverse can keep up when it comes to the standard and available features. Some of the standard features here include tri-zone climate control,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and OnStar connected services. Optional features include blind-spot monitoring, leather interior, darkened aesthetics, automatic emergency braking, traction-mode select, perforated leather upholstery, and a power sunroof.
